3. The Linguistic Amplifier Effect

A single "okay" is often a neutral confirmation. The addition of "Oh" and the subsequent repetition transforms the word into a dramatic conversational tool.

  • "Oh": The initial "Oh" signals a shift in mental state—a sudden realization, a surprise, or a moment of dawning awareness. It prepares the listener for the subsequent reaction.
  • The Repetition (Okay, Okay, Okay): Repeating the word slows down the communication and signals that the information received is significant enough to require processing time. It’s an audible sign of the brain catching up to a new reality. In digital communication, it can express:
    • Sarcasm/Resignation: "Oh, okay, okay, okay (I get it, but I don't like it)."
    • Deepened Understanding: "Oh, okay, okay, okay (Now that you've explained it, I finally comprehend the full scope)."
    • Excited Confirmation: "Oh, okay, okay, okay (That's amazing, let's go!)."

4. The Historical Meme Precursors

The current "Oh Okay Okay Okay" trend stands on the shoulders of several foundational internet phenomena that established the "okay" as a potent meme entity. Understanding these predecessors provides the necessary topical authority.

  • The "Okay Guy" Meme: Dating back over a decade, the "Okay Guy" (often a simple, downtrodden-looking Microsoft Paint drawing) established the word "okay" as a symbol of passive resignation or quiet defeat.
  • The "OK Boomer" Catchphrase: This phrase, which gained widespread attention in 2019, weaponized the word "OK" as a dismissive, generational put-down.
  • The "Okay Movement" on Vine: This earlier viral trend featured a clip of a grinning man timidly saying "okay," used for comedic effect, demonstrating the word's power in short-form video.

These historical memes show that the word "okay" has long been a vessel for complex, often ironic, emotional responses in digital culture. The current iteration is simply the latest, most rhythmically complex evolution.

7. The Broader Linguistic Legacy of "OK"

Ultimately, the "Oh Okay Okay Okay" phenomenon is a fresh chapter in the long, fascinating history of the word "OK." The word "OK" (or "Okay") is arguably the most recognizable word in the world, with an origin story dating back to the 1830s in Boston newspapers as an in-joke abbreviation for "All Correct" (O.K.).

The current viral trend proves that this simple, two-letter word remains incredibly versatile. By simply adding an "Oh" and multiplying the "Okay," the digital generation has successfully re-engineered a 19th-century linguistic joke into a 21st-century internet phenomenon, ensuring its legacy continues to evolve and dominate digital conversations well into 2025 and beyond.
